CSS是一種用于網頁設計的語言,可以用于控制網頁的樣式和布局。在CSS中,我們經常需要移動元素的位置。但是有些時候,我們希望移動元素的位置,但是保持元素原來的位置不變。那么,該如何實現呢?
.position-fixed { position: fixed; top: 100px; left: 100px; }
上面的代碼是實現移動元素位置不變的方法之一:使用position屬性的fixed值。當一個元素的position屬性被設置為fixed,它就會脫離文檔流,并根據窗口來定位。它的位置是相對于瀏覽器窗口而不是文檔。因此,即使滾動頁面,它的位置不會改變。
在上面的代碼中,我們給定了一個class為position-fixed的元素。它的位置(top和left)被設置為100px。這意味著,無論頁面上的其他元素如何移動,它始終位于100px和100px的位置。
總之,CSS提供了多種方法來移動元素的位置。使用position屬性的fixed值是一種實現移動元素位置不變的方法。這對于需要固定元素,如導航菜單和懸浮廣告條非常有用。